Rooted in tradition Trawling Through Time: The Evolution of Fishing Boats

Fishing boats have progressed dramatically over the ages. Early vessels, constructed from planks, were basic in design. They relied on oars to cross the oceans. {As technology advanced|, however, new materials and propulsion systems emerged. Fishing boats adopted metal hulls, engines, and increasingly sophisticated navigation tools.

Current-day fishing boats| are marvels of engineering, equipped with advanced sensors to detect fish populations. Moreover, they feature automated systems to increase efficiency. The evolution of fishing boats is a testament to human ingenuity and the constant quest to exploit the resources of the seas.

Upgrading Seafaring Technology: A Modern Fleet

The maritime sector is in a period of rapid transformation. Traditional methods, once reliant click here on simple tools like gillnets and analog navigation, are being replaced by cutting-edge technology. Modern ships are now equipped with sophisticated GPS systems for precise positioning, automated processes for enhanced efficiency, and advanced connectivity to facilitate seamless cooperation between vessels and shore personnel. This transition toward a more modernized fleet is not only enhancing safety and efficiency but also cutting down on the environmental impact of maritime operations.

  • Additionally, advancements in materials science are leading to the development of stronger, lighter, and more fuel-efficient ships.
  • Consequently, the outlook of the maritime fleet is bright, with continued innovation promising to shape the industry for years to come.
